Dishes
Oil DipSichuan cuisine commonly uses oil dip as a dipping sauce, primarily made from sesame oil, chili oil, garlic paste, green onions, crushed peanuts, soy sauce, and vinegar. To prepare it, mix sesame oil and chili oil in proportion, then add finely chopped garlic and green onions. Adjust the taste by adding appropriate amounts of soy sauce and vinegar, and finally sprinkle crushed peanuts to enhance aroma and texture.
Spicy Pickled Pepper PotA spicy and tangy dish made with pork, vegetables, and pickled chili peppers, simmered in a flavorful broth.
Stone Pot Mud CarpFresh mud carp is cooked in a stone pot with ginger, garlic, and chili, resulting in tender fish and rich, aromatic broth.
Stone Pot Frog LegsA dish featuring fresh frog legs stir-fried in a hot stone pot with chili, garlic, and ginger, resulting in tender meat and rich aroma.
Yellow CroakerYellow catfish is a dish made primarily from yellow catfish. The fish is cleaned, pan-fried until golden on both sides, then stewed or braised with chili, ginger, garlic, and other seasonings to infuse flavor into the flesh.
